1      // 数组去重
 2      function distinct(temp){
 3      // Array.prototype.distinct = function(){
 4          var ar = temp;
 5              obj = {};
 6              len = ar.length;
 7              newArr = [];
 8              i = 0;    
 9          for(i;i<len;i++){
10              if(!obj[ar[i]]){
11                  obj[ar[i]] = "abc";
12                  newArr.push(ar[i]);
13              }
14          }
15          return newArr;
16      }
View Code